Wireless phones use radio waves to
accommodate many users on a radio
network. Radio communications do not
always provide the same voice quality and
reliability as your land-line phone. When
using your wireless phone, you may
experience dropped calls, crosstalk, echo,
speech distortion, or other voice quality
degradation.
These distortions are generally caused by the
wireless network.
Your speakerphone cannot improve the
phone’s performance. Variations in voice
quality are louder when heard with the
speaker than when in privacy mode because
they are amplified. If you experience a badly
distorted call, check that the phone has a
good signal level. If your signal level is good
and you are still experiencing poor voice
quality, hang up and redial the number to get
a different channel.

Incoming Calls
When placing a call, you will not always hear
the touch-tones through the speakerphone.
This is a normal condition and not a defect.
It may take a moment for the speakerphone
to alternate between you and the person you
are talking to on the phone. You may need to
pause for a moment to hear.
